The Silver Lining Award!

I was invited to a school to give out awards to students on their Annual Day. One category among the prizes that really touched me was a “Silver Lining Award” given to a student in each class who has progressed most from one term to another. It may even be a student who is at the bottom of his class, but if he has gone from 20% to 40%, i.e. doubled his marks compared to others who only made marginal improvement he or she was given a citation to acknowledge and appreciate his progress.

Those who stand first in academics or extra-curricular activities inevitably keep getting awards. I sincerely hope and wish that we learn to appreciate, reward and encourage students who are struggling and progressing, rather than just those who are perpetual toppers. This will motivate all students to put in more efforts without comparing themselves with others.
